Job Details


The Talent Acquisition team is seeking an accomplished Talent Acquisition Partner who will provide full-life cycle recruiting and strategic business partner support for a number of business functions across Europe.

Client Details

A talented team of 15,000 individuals with unique backgrounds, perspectives and experiences. A business that appreciates you are more than your day job. A company who encourage quality of life outside of the office in addition to promoting career progression and opportunity.

Description

  • Operate as a trusted advisor to the business by establishing and maintaining strong relationships with hiring teams, senior management and departmental heads.
  • Provide a tailored end-to-end talent acquisition service from initial briefing through to direct sourcing, screening/interviewing candidates, providing feedback and managing the offer process all whilst adding value at each stage of the process.
  • Create strong talent pipelines by developing programs for proactive sourcing of qualified applicants utilizing employer branding across a smart mix of social media and other recruitment channels.
  • Work closely with your Senior Talent Acquisition Partner to collect and coordinate aggregate data for talent pools and translate the data into insights that drive deliberate action plans at the appropriate levels.
  • Proactively promote career opportunities to Visa's internal employee population in order to meet our internal mobility goals.
  • Participate in the rollout of talent acquisition related initiatives, championing and optimizing programs such as the employee referral program.
  • Collaborate with HRBPs and business leaders to understand strategic direction from both a function and country perspective that will enable the creation of talent acquisition strategies to align to company vision.

Profile

  • Significant full-cycle in-house corporate talent acquisition experience obtained from a global fast-paced environment.
  • Experience in all areas of sourcing - LinkedIn, local tools, social media, referrals, internal mobility programs, etc.
  • Exceptional interviewing, communication, negotiation/closing, organization and problem solving skills.
  • Previous experience in capturing metrics and delivering compelling recruitment insights to the business using data and analytics.
  • Proven ability to engage and manage multiple stakeholders and requisitions in a fast-paced environment.
  • Comfortable working in ambiguous-led environments with a bias towards transformation and change.
  • Proven deep stakeholder expertise including collaborating effectively with sourcers, hiring managers and HR Business Partners.
  • Proficient in effectively utilizing applicant-tracking systems.
  • Ability to create thinking around employer brand activation and initiatives to build talent pipelines.
  • Consultative, solutions focused style, comfortable working in an environment that demands strong deliverables and excellent service.
  • Experience of sourcing diverse talent for niche roles.
